Watch: UP man abuses, forces car driver to kneel and apologise over parking dispute; Congress links him to BJP

Screenshot from viral video (Courtesy: Congress)

NEW DELHI: The Congress on Tuesday shared a video showing a man, allegedly UP BJP leader Vikul Chaprana, abusing another man and forcing him to kneel and apologise.Calling it the “true face” of the BJP, which governs Uttar Pradesh, the Congress demanded the immediate arrest of the individual involved.”Watch this video: The man hurling filthy abuses is BJP leader Vikul Chaprana. In a minor altercation over a car on the road, he got so furious that he hurled filthy abuses at the other person, made him rub his nose on the ground, and forced him to kneel and beg for forgiveness,” the grand old party posted on X. The Congress added that the abuser name-dropped “big names” to “show off his influence.””This is the true face of BJP—where leaders see themselves as kings and treat ordinary people like insects. This thug should be arrested,” it said.In the clip, the man is heard mentioning “Somendra Tomar.”On September 5, Dr Somendra Tomar, the local MLA and minister of state for energy in the UP government, had extended birthday wishes to Vipul Chakrana, identifying him as the vice president of the ruling party’s Meerut district Kisan Morcha (farmers’ front).

Screenshot 2025-10-21 175536

Somendra Tomar’s Facebook post

Meerut Police confirmed the incident in the comments section, saying that the accused has been arrested. “There was a dispute between both parties in the case regarding vehicle parking. The accused is in police custody. A case has been registered based on the complaint filed by the complainant, and action is being taken,” police said, without giving details.
